How to Reach Puri, India

Puri, located in the eastern state of Odisha, is a popular tourist destination known for its beautiful beaches and the famous Jagannath Temple. If you are planning a trip to Puri, here are some ways to reach this enchanting city:

By Air:

The nearest airport to Puri is Biju Patnaik International Airport in Bhubaneswar, which is approximately 60 kilometers away. From the airport, you can hire a taxi or take a bus to reach Puri. Several domestic airlines operate regular flights to Bhubaneswar from major cities in India.

By Train:

Puri has its own railway station, which is well-connected to major cities in India. The Puri Railway Station is located in the heart of the city and is easily accessible. There are regular trains from cities like Kolkata, Delhi, Chennai, Mumbai, and Bangalore, making it convenient for travelers to reach Puri by train.

By Road:

Puri is well-connected by road to various cities in Odisha and neighboring states. The city is easily accessible through a network of national highways. You can either drive your own vehicle or hire a taxi to reach Puri. Regular bus services are also available from nearby cities like Bhubaneswar, Cuttack, and Kolkata.

Getting to know Puri, India

Puri is a coastal city located in the state of Odisha, India. Situated on the eastern coast of the country, it is renowned for its beautiful beaches, religious significance, and rich cultural heritage. Puri is home to the revered Jagannath Temple, one of the Char Dham pilgrimage sites for Hindus.

With its pristine sandy beaches stretching along the Bay of Bengal, Puri is a popular tourist destination for both domestic and international travelers. These beaches offer a serene environment for relaxation, sunbathing, and various water activities like swimming and surfing. Additionally, the annual Puri Beach Festival, known for its art, crafts, and cultural performances, attracts a large number of visitors.

The Jagannath Temple, dedicated to Lord Jagannath, is the most significant landmark in Puri. It is famous for its Rath Yatra, or Chariot Festival, held during the monsoon season, which attracts millions of devotees. The temple complex also houses various other shrines and structures of religious importance.

Puri is also known for its vibrant traditions, music, and dance forms like Odissi. The city's vibrant street markets offer a wide range of handicrafts, textiles, and intricate artwork, making it a haven for shoppers and art enthusiasts.

Aside from its religious and cultural attractions, Puri is also a gateway to explore other nearby attractions such as the Chilika Lake, Asia's largest brackish water lagoon, and the Sun Temple at Konark, a UNESCO World Heritage Site.
